Chemical Engineering Progress (CEP) is AIChE's flagship publication.  This monthly magazine provides essential technical and professional information to practicing chemical engineers through their membership in AIChE.  SBE members receive the bi-annual BioSupplement, a special section to CEP that explores topics of interest to our members.  The most recent issue on was published in July 2011 and includes articles:

 

Don't Let Baffle Tray Flood Baffle You

By Henry Z. Kister and Matthew Olsson
Use this new correlation based on window liquid velocity to predict baffle tray capacity.

 

Reduce Piloting Time and Cost

By David A. Berg and Michael T. Cleary
Pilot-scale experimentation is essential to establish a sound foundation for a new chemical processing unit. These best practices can reduce the time and cost involved in process development. 

 

Developing Screening Cost Estimates

By Richard P. Palluzi, P.E.
Making decisions based on estimates derived from weak data is counterproductive. Use this established methodology to prepare scoping and screening cost estimates for pilot plants quickly and accurately.
